Bob Lee (footballer, born 1953)

Bob Lee (born 2 February 1953) is an English former professional footballer who played for Sunderland as a forward.

[1] While at Leicester he had a short loan spell with Doncaster Rovers from 1974 to 1975 making 14 appearances with four goals.

[1] Lee signed for Sunderland in 1976 and made his debut on 2 October 1976 against Everton in a 1–0 defeat at Roker Park.

[3] After playing for Sunderland he signed for Bristol Rovers in 1980 and went on to make 23 appearances, and scoring two goals.

[1] Lee later went on to become a pub landlord in the 1990s in one of the villages close to his birthplace, Melton Mowbray.
